12953143
0x957aae0e62ca125dffc0c3e8c3260c3601ac6b54fc0a194e2b05b7572877c5db
Transactions0
Height12953143
Confirmations3747243
Timestamp317 days 8 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xe8545047b8045cc6
Bits
Difficulty0x21f7d818